biotech pharma products encompass a wide range of therapies and treatments that are derived from biological sources. These products are often more complex and targeted compared to traditional pharmaceuticals, as they are designed to interact with specific biological pathways or targets in the body. Biotech products are typically developed using advanced biotechnologies such as genetic engineering, cell culture, and recombinant DNA technology, which allow scientists to create highly specialized therapies that can target specific diseases or conditions.

One of the key advantages of biotech pharma products is their ability to target specific biological pathways or molecules that are involved in disease processes. This targeted approach can lead to more effective treatments with fewer side effects compared to traditional pharmaceuticals. For example, monoclonal antibodies, which are a type of biologic therapy, can be designed to bind to specific proteins on cancer cells, triggering an immune response that helps to kill the cancer cells while sparing healthy cells. This targeted approach has revolutionized cancer treatment and has led to significant improvements in patient outcomes.

biotech pharma products have also played a critical role in the development of personalized medicine, which aims to tailor treatments to individual patients based on their unique genetic makeup and characteristics. By analyzing a patient’s genetic profile, doctors can identify personalized treatment options that are more likely to be effective and less toxic. This personalized approach has the potential to improve patient outcomes and reduce healthcare costs by eliminating the trial-and-error approach to drug therapy.

Another significant advancement in biotech pharma products is the development of gene therapies, which involve the delivery of genetic material into a patient’s cells to treat or prevent disease. Gene therapies have the potential to cure genetic disorders by correcting or replacing faulty genes that cause disease. For example, gene therapies have been developed to treat rare genetic disorders such as spinal muscular atrophy and inherited retinal diseases, offering new hope to patients who previously had limited treatment options.

biotech pharma products have also been instrumental in the fight against infectious diseases, particularly in the development of vaccines. Vaccines are biological products that stimulate the immune system to produce antibodies against specific pathogens, providing immunity against infectious diseases. The development of vaccines has been a major breakthrough in modern medicine, leading to the eradication of diseases such as smallpox and the control of others such as polio and measles. Biotech pharmaceutical companies continue to innovate in vaccine development, with promising new vaccines being developed for diseases such as COVID-19 and malaria.
